Creating a consistent study schedule is crucial for developing effective study habits because it helps establish a routine, making studying a regular part of your day. When students commit to a specific time and environment for studying, they condition their minds to focus better during those sessions. This consistency reinforces discipline and allows for better time management, ensuring that adequate time is dedicated to each subject.

Moreover, a well-structured schedule can help in pacing material review, allowing for spaced repetition, which is a proven technique to enhance retention. By knowing when and where you will study, you can also reduce procrastination and create a more productive learning environment. This dependable structure contributes significantly to the overall effectiveness of study habits.

While avoiding distractions, setting specific goals, and utilizing active learning techniques are all beneficial strategies in their own right, they can be more effectively implemented within the framework of a consistent study schedule. Without that routine, it can be easy to lose track of time or forget to engage in active learning, making a solid schedule foundational to success in studying.
